SECURE 2.0 Act – More Relief for Plan Administrators
On this episode of Williams Mullen's Benefits Companion, host Brydon DeWitt shares more good news for benefit plan administrators, this time under the banner of the SECURE 2.0 Act. Highlights include a discussion of the relief granted for the self-correction process and the recovery of inadvertent benefit overpayments.
Beneficial Changes for Your Retirement Planning # 382
With the SECURE 2.0 Act signed into law, there are many changes that can impact your retirement planning over the next few years. Mercer Advisors’ John Walker, Regional Vice President, and Mercer Advisors’ Dennis Jablonoski Certified Retirement Plan Specialist, discuss some of these revisions. There are new opportunities regarding required minimum distributions, workplace retirement plans, educational savings plans and more. SECURE 2.0 Act – Highlights and To Do’s for 2023
At the end of 2022, President Biden signed the highly anticipated SECURE 2.0 Act into law. On this episode of Williams Mullen's Benefits Companion, host Brydon DeWitt reviews highlights of the new law, including what employers need to focus on for this fiscal year to stay in compliance.
